What is the peak voltage of a lead acid battery?
Then, the voltage is limited to the peak voltage until the current drops (to 3-5% of the C rate for lead acid batteries). Standard "12V" Lead-acid batteries are six cells; the peak charge voltage is between 13.8 and 14.7V (at 25C, this value is temperature dependent); however prolonged time at this voltage will cause damage.

Do lead-acid batteries need a specific charging voltage and current?
It is important to note that lead-acid batteries require a specific charging voltage and current to prevent overcharging or undercharging. Overcharging can cause irreversible damage to the battery and shorten its lifespan, while undercharging can lead to sulfation and reduce the battery’s capacity.
